An investigation was launched Friday after officers with the St. Pete Police Department found what they're calling a "suspicious package" outside of the department's headquarters.
At a press conference, Police Chief Anthony Holloway said at around 2:30 p.m., a maintenance employee came outside and saw a "suspicious" vehicle in the parking lot.
A supervisor was notified and searched around the area before finding a suitcase under one of the department's forensic vehicles, according to Holloway.
During an investigation, officers reportedly reviewed security footage which showed a woman driving up in a car and then pulling a large suitcase out before walking around the wall, under a security barrier and into a restricted area with the suitcase.
Officers ran a tag on the car and then went to the address associated with it — located off of 4th Avenue North.
